苹果CMS是一个功能强大的内容管理系统(CMS),它可以帮助用户轻松管理网站内容,当遇到500内部错误时,苹果CMS提供了一系列的错误处理机制来解决问题,它会显示详细的错误信息,帮助用户定位问题所在,苹果CMS具有自动修复功能,可以在一定程度上自动纠正一些语法或配置错误,它还提供了一套完整的日志系统,方便用户追踪和解决潜在的问题,如果以上方法无法解决问题,苹果CMS还提供了详细的错误排查指南和专业的客户支持服务,确保用户能够快速恢复网站的正常运行。
在网站运营过程中,我们经常会遇到各种各样的错误,500内部错误是最让人头疼的一种,它意味着服务器收到了一个无效的响应,但具体原因却不得而知,这种错误不仅会影响用户体验,还可能导致数据丢失或服务器损坏,在遇到500内部错误时,我们应该如何解决呢?本文将结合苹果CMS的特点,探讨如何有效解决这一问题。
500内部错误的原因及常见解决方法
我们需要了解500内部错误的原因,这通常是由于服务器端处理脚本时出现了问题,可能是代码错误、配置文件错误、权限设置不当等导致的,常见的解决方法包括:
-
检查代码和配置文件:仔细检查网站的所有代码,确保没有语法错误或逻辑错误,也要检查配置文件,如.htaccess、nginx.conf等,确保它们的设置正确无误。
-
查看服务器日志:当发生500错误时,服务器通常会生成一份错误日志,通过查看这份日志,我们可以找到错误的详细信息,从而进行针对性的修复。
-
检查权限设置:确保网站的所有文件和目录都设置了正确的权限,文件权限应设置为644,目录权限应设置为755。
苹果CMS特有的错误解决策略
既然我们知道了500内部错误的原因,那么针对苹果CMS(Content Management System),我们还可以采取一些特有的解决策略:
-
更新CMS和插件:确保你使用的苹果CMS及其所有插件都是最新版本,过时的版本可能存在已知的安全漏洞或bug,导致500错误。
-
清理缓存:苹果CMS可能会生成一些缓存文件,如果这些文件过多或过旧,也可能导致500错误,定期清理缓存文件,可以解决这个问题。
-
检查数据库连接:确保CMS与数据库的连接正常,如果数据库连接出现问题,CMS可能无法正常工作,从而导致500错误。
-
使用CDN加速:对于流量较大的网站,使用CDN(内容分发网络)可以加快页面加载速度,减少服务器压力,从而降低500错误的发生概率。
预防措施和日常维护
为了避免500内部错误的发生,我们还需要采取一些预防措施和进行日常维护:
-
定期备份:定期备份网站的数据和文件,以防万一发生意外。
-
安全更新:及时安装服务器和安全软件的更新,以防止已知漏洞被利用。
-
监控和报警:建立一套完善的监控系统,实时监控网站的运行状态,一旦发现异常,立即触发报警通知相关人员。
解决苹果CMS的500内部错误需要综合运用多种方法,通过深入了解错误原因、掌握苹果CMS的特点以及采取有效的预防措施和日常维护,我们可以大大降低500错误的发生概率,提升网站的稳定性和安全性。